Apple iTunes is a media player and a media library application that is used to organize and play digital music, videos, TV shows, podcasts, radio, apps and ebooks. It was released on January 9, 2001.
The latest version of Apple iTunes is known for its compatibility with various devices such as iPhones, iPads and iPods. It can be used to download movies and music from the internet or from your computer to your device. It can also be used to manage your downloaded music and videos on your device or on your computer.
